el-tree懒加载无子级数据时去掉下拉箭头


 

 

点击机构树,子机构没有数据时候 去掉下拉箭头。

 

 

 

方法一:

data() {
        return {
            treeData: [],
            defaultProps: {
                children: 'children',
                label: 'label',
                isLeaf: (data, node) => {
                    if(node.level === 2) {
                        return true
                    }
                },
            }
        }
    },

  

        //tree加载子机构
        loadSubOrg(node, resolve) {
            let orgId = node.data.id;
            if (node.level === 1) {
                this.$http({
                    method: 'get',
                    url: this.$api.organization.findChildTreeNode + '/' + orgId,
                }).then((res) => {
                    console.log(res, 'res')
                    resolve(res.nodes)
                }).catch(err => {
                    console.log(err);
                })
            }
        },

使用css隐藏箭头图标

/deep/ .is-leaf.el-tree-node_expand-icon  {
    display:none;
}

  

 


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M